Marion County sits over the Floridan Aquifer, one of the most mineral-rich groundwater systems in the Southeast. That means the water coming out of your well is often loaded with calcium, magnesium, and iron — and every wash cycle deposits a little more of that chemistry inside your appliance.

What Marion County Well Water Actually Looks Like

Let's talk numbers. The USGS classifies water above 7 grains per gallon (GPG) as "hard." Marion County residential wells commonly test between 9 and 18 GPG, with some outliers pushing higher depending on well depth and proximity to limestone formations. Iron levels frequently run 0.5–3.0 mg/L or more — well above the EPA's aesthetic guideline of 0.3 mg/L.

That's not just a taste problem. That's chemistry that accumulates inside every appliance connected to your water line.

How Scale and Iron Destroy a Washing Machine

Here's what's actually happening inside that machine:

Scale buildup — calcium and magnesium deposits — coats the inside of the drum, the water inlet valves, the internal hoses, and the pump. Scale acts as an insulator on any heating element, forcing it to work harder to reach temperature. It also narrows hose diameter over time, reducing water flow and stressing the pump motor.

Iron leaves rust-colored stains on the drum interior, rubber seals, and gaskets. Beyond the cosmetic damage, iron creates a rough surface that accelerates mechanical wear on seals and valves. It also reacts with laundry detergents — most common detergents aren't formulated for high-iron water — leaving your clothes looking dingy, faded, or with orange-brown streaks.

A washing machine on untreated hard water in Marion County typically lasts 6–9 years. The same machine on softened water routinely runs 12–15 years. That's a $700–$1,200 replacement you're either avoiding or financing with every load of laundry.

Warning Signs Your Machine Is Already Under Attack

You don't need a water test to spot early damage. Look for:

  • White, chalky residue inside the drum or around the detergent drawer
  • Rust-colored stains or an orange film on the drum walls or rubber gasket
  • Laundry that comes out stiff, dull, or still smells like mildew
  • Clothes fading faster than the manufacturer's expected lifespan
  • A grinding or straining sound during the fill cycle (restricted inlet valve)
  • Higher-than-recommended detergent use with mediocre results

If you're checking two or more boxes here, your water is already doing damage.

The Right Fix for Marion County Well Water

The approach depends on what's actually in your water, which is why a free water test is always the starting point.

If your primary issue is hardness: A properly sized water softener handles it directly. For most Marion County households, a 32,000–48,000 grain capacity softener covers daily demand with standard regeneration cycles.

If you have iron above 0.5 mg/L: A softener alone will eventually foul with iron. You need a dedicated iron and sulfur removal system ahead of the softener, or a combination unit rated for iron.

If you want clean drinking water on top of that: An under-sink reverse osmosis system gives you filtered water at the tap without affecting the whole-house treatment budget.
